How to Transfer Messages to New iPhone: A Step-by-Step Guide

March 31, 2025 By Matthew Burleigh

Transferring messages to a new iPhone can be a breeze if you know the right steps. The process is simple: back up your messages on your old iPhone, then restore them on your new device. This can be done using iCloud or iTunes. Once the backup is complete, set up your new iPhone, and restore the messages from the backup. It’s quick, efficient, and ensures that you won’t lose any important conversations.

How to Transfer Messages to a New iPhone

Transferring messages to a new iPhone is a straightforward process that will have your text history safely moved over in no time.

Step 1: Back Up Your Old iPhone

Make sure to back up your old iPhone using iCloud or iTunes.

To back up via iCloud, go to Settings, tap your name, then iCloud, and select iCloud Backup. Tap "Back Up Now" to start the process. For iTunes, connect your device to a computer, open iTunes, and choose "Back Up Now." Either method will save your messages in the backup.

Step 2: Set Up Your New iPhone

Turn on your new iPhone and follow the on-screen setup instructions.

During the setup, you’ll reach a screen asking if you want to restore from a backup. Here, you’ll choose the backup method you used earlier. For iCloud, you’ll sign in to your Apple ID and select the latest backup. With iTunes, connect your new device to the computer and select the backup to restore.

Step 3: Restore Messages from Backup

Select the appropriate backup on your new iPhone to restore your messages.

Once chosen, your iPhone will begin restoring the backup, including all your messages. This process can take some time, depending on the size of the backup, so patience is key.

Step 4: Verify Messages

After the restore is complete, check the Messages app to ensure everything transferred correctly.

Open the Messages app to browse through your conversations. If your messages are present, the transfer was successful. If not, you may need to repeat the restore process.

Step 5: Finish Setting Up Your New iPhone

Complete any remaining setup steps and start using your new iPhone.

Once the messages and other data are restored, your new iPhone is ready to use. Customize any settings you had on your old device to make the transition seamless.

Tips for Transferring Messages to a New iPhone

  • Ensure your old iPhone is fully charged or connected to power before starting the backup process.
  • If using iCloud, make sure there’s enough storage space available for the backup.
  • Keep both devices close together during the transfer to prevent any interruptions.
  • Use a Wi-Fi connection for iCloud backups to avoid using mobile data.
  • If you encounter issues, restarting both devices can help resolve temporary glitches.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I transfer messages without a backup?

Unfortunately, without a backup, you won’t be able to transfer messages directly from an old iPhone to a new one.

How long does the process take?

The time can vary based on the size of your backup and your internet speed, but it generally takes anywhere from a few minutes to an hour.

What if I have a lot of photos and videos in my messages?

These will be included in the backup, which might increase the size and time needed to complete the process.

Can I transfer messages from Android to iPhone?

Yes, using the "Move to iOS" app, you can transfer messages from an Android device to an iPhone.

Will the transfer affect my contacts or apps?

No, the transfer focuses on messages, but a full backup and restore will include contacts, apps, and other data.
